The complexity of designing and implementing metaheuristics
Autor
Soto R.
Crawford B.
Olivares R.
Galleguillos C.
Crawford K.
Johnson F.
Paredes F.
Resumen
Optimization problems can be found in several real application domains such as engineering, medicine, mathematics, mechanics, physics, mining, games, design, and biology, among others. There exist several techniques to the efficient solving of these problems, which can be organized in two groups: exact and approximate methods. Metaheuristics are one of the most famous and widely used approximate methods for solving optimization problems. Most of them are known for being inspired on interesting behaviors that can be found on the nature, such as the way in which ants, bees and fishes found food, or the way in which fireflies and bats move on the environment. However, solving optimization problems via metaheuristics is not always a simple trip. In this paper, we analyze and discuss from an usability standpoint how the effort needed to design and implement efficient and robust metaheuristics can be conveniently managed and reduced. © Springer International Publishing Switzerland 2015.
Colecciones
Ítems relacionados
Mostrando ítems relacionados por Título, autor o materia.
-
Article
Using autonomous search for solving constraint satisfaction problems via new modern approaches (2020)
Soto R.; Crawford B.; Olivares R.; Galleguillos C.; Castro C.; Johnson F.; Paredes F.; Norero E. (Elsevier B.V., 2016) -
Conference Paper
Solving manufacturing cell design problems using an artificial fish swarm algorithm (2020)
Soto R.; Crawford B.; Vega E.; Paredes F. (Springer Verlag, 2015) -
Conference Paper
Optimization for UI design via metaheuristics (2020)
Soto R.; Crawford B.; Almonacid B.; Niklander S.; Olguín E. (Springer Verlag, 2016)